The Foundational Role of Hydration: More Than Just Quenching Thirst

Hydration is perhaps the most underestimated component of overall health and weight management. Our bodies are composed of roughly 60% water, and every single cellular process, from nutrient transport to waste elimination, depends on adequate hydration. When we discuss how to use lemon water for weight loss, the primary benefit often begins with this fundamental aspect.

Why Hydration Matters for Weight Loss

Think of your body as a sophisticated engine. Just as an engine needs oil to run smoothly, your body needs water for optimal function. Dehydration, even mild, can slow down your metabolism, impair fat breakdown, and even be mistaken for hunger, leading to unnecessary calorie intake.

  • Increased Metabolism: Studies suggest that drinking more water can temporarily boost your metabolic rate. This means your body burns more calories at rest, which, over time, can contribute to weight loss. For instance, cold water requires your body to expend a small amount of energy to warm it to body temperature, slightly increasing calorie expenditure.
  • Reduced Food Intake: Drinking water, especially before meals, can create a feeling of fullness, leading to reduced calorie consumption. This simple strategy can be incredibly effective in curbing overeating without feeling deprived.
  • Enhanced Fat Breakdown: Proper hydration is crucial for lipolysis, the process by which your body breaks down fats for energy. When you're well-hydrated, your body can more efficiently utilize stored fat, supporting your weight loss efforts.
  • Improved Energy Levels: Dehydration can cause fatigue, making it harder to stay active and motivated. Staying hydrated ensures your energy levels remain steady, supporting your ability to engage in regular physical activity.

Digestive Harmony: The Gut-Weight Connection

Beyond simple hydration, how to use lemon water for weight loss is closely tied to its impact on digestion and gut health. A healthy digestive system is foundational to overall wellness and plays a critical role in how our bodies process food, absorb nutrients, and manage weight.

The Role of Citric Acid in Digestion

Lemons are rich in citric acid, which can stimulate the production of digestive fluids, including gastric acid, in the stomach. This is essential for breaking down food, especially proteins, into smaller, more absorbable components. When digestion is efficient, your body can extract nutrients more effectively, which supports satiety and reduces cravings for nutrient-poor foods.

  • Enhanced Nutrient Absorption: Optimal gastric acid levels ensure that vitamins and minerals from your food are properly absorbed. This is vital not just for overall health, but also because micronutrient deficiencies can sometimes trigger cravings, as your body seeks the nutrients it's missing.
  • Reduced Bloating and Discomfort: The potassium in lemons helps regulate sodium levels in the body, which can contribute to reducing water retention and alleviating occasional bloating. For many, persistent bloating is a source of discomfort and can make one feel heavier and sluggish. Incorporating lemon water can help the body maintain better fluid balance, fostering a feeling of lightness and comfort.
  • Supporting Peristalsis: Some research suggests that pre-meal intake of lemon water may promote peristalsis, the wave-like contractions that move food through the digestive tract. This can contribute to more regular bowel movements and prevent constipation, further supporting a healthy digestive system.

A Rich Source of Vitamin C and Antioxidants

Lemons are renowned for their high vitamin C content, a powerful antioxidant. Vitamin C helps protect your cells from damage caused by free radicals, molecules that contribute to inflammation and can lead to various chronic diseases.

  • Immune System Support: Regular intake of vitamin C can bolster your immune system, helping your body ward off common illnesses. When you feel your best, you’re more likely to stick to your healthy eating and exercise routines.
  • Skin Health: Vitamin C plays a crucial role in collagen synthesis, a protein essential for maintaining skin elasticity and a youthful appearance. Adequate vitamin C intake can contribute to smoother, healthier-looking skin, supporting your natural glow from within.
  • Iron Absorption: Vitamin C significantly enhances the absorption of non-heme iron (iron found in plant-based foods), which is vital for preventing iron deficiency and related fatigue. Improved iron absorption can boost energy levels, helping you stay active and engaged in your wellness journey.

Kidney Stone Prevention

For those susceptible to kidney stones, lemon water can be a valuable preventive measure. The citric acid in lemons can increase urine volume and pH, making the urine less acidic and creating an environment less favorable for stone formation. Experts often recommend mixing about 4 ounces of lemon juice concentrate with water daily for this purpose. However, always consult with a healthcare provider before making significant dietary changes, especially if you have existing health conditions.

Appetite Management and Blood Sugar Regulation

Drinking water before meals, including lemon water, can promote satiety and help manage appetite. Citrus fruits, like lemons, may also help stabilize blood sugar levels. While not a direct treatment for diabetes, supporting balanced blood sugar can prevent energy crashes and intense cravings, making it easier to adhere to a healthy eating plan.

Practical Strategies for Incorporating Lemon Water

Now that we've covered the "why," let's dive into the "how" of making lemon water a seamless part of your daily routine. Remember, consistency is key, and finding a method that suits your lifestyle will ensure long-term success.

When and How to Drink Lemon Water

  • Morning Ritual: Starting your day with a glass of lemon water is a popular and effective strategy. It helps kickstart your metabolism, rehydrates your body after sleep, and can stimulate digestion before your first meal. Whether you prefer it warm or cold is largely a matter of personal preference.
    • Warm Lemon Water: Some find warm lemon water soothing and believe it stimulates digestion more effectively. It can also be calming, making it a good choice in the evening.
    • Cold Lemon Water: Cold lemon water is refreshing, especially in warmer climates, and some evidence suggests it may lead to a very slight increase in calorie burn as your body works to warm it up.
  • Before Meals: Drinking a glass of lemon water 15-30 minutes before meals can help you feel fuller, potentially reducing your overall calorie intake during the meal. It also preps your digestive system for incoming food.
  • Throughout the Day: Keep a pitcher of lemon-infused water in your refrigerator to sip on throughout the day. This encourages continuous hydration and helps replace less healthy beverage choices.

Making Your Lemon Water: Simple Steps

Squeeze the juice of half a lemon (approximately 1-2 tablespoons) into 8-12 ounces of filtered water. Adjust the amount of lemon to your taste. For convenience, you can prepare lemon ice cubes by squeezing juice into ice trays and freezing, then simply drop a few into your water as needed.

Enhancing Your Lemon Water: Add-Ins for Extra Benefits

While pure lemon water is effective, incorporating additional ingredients can amplify its benefits and add variety:

  • Ginger: Fresh ginger slices can soothe digestion, ease nausea, and offer anti-inflammatory properties.
  • Turmeric & Black Pepper: Turmeric is a potent antioxidant and anti-inflammatory agent. Adding a pinch of black pepper helps your body absorb curcumin, turmeric's active compound.
  • Cucumber: Slices of cucumber add a refreshing taste and extra hydration, as cucumbers have a high water content and provide vitamin K.
  • Chia Seeds: These tiny seeds are packed with fiber, omega-3 fatty acids, and protein, supporting digestive health and promoting satiety. Mix them in well and let them sit for a few minutes to expand.
  • Apple Cider Vinegar (ACV): A splash of ACV (1-2 teaspoons) may further support blood sugar regulation and lipid-lowering effects, but be mindful of its strong taste and potential for enamel erosion.
  • Honey (in moderation): A small amount of raw honey can add natural sweetness and additional antioxidants, but remember it adds calories.
  • Mint Leaves: Fresh mint can enhance flavor and provide a calming effect, aiding digestion.

Setting Realistic Expectations and Avoiding Myths

It's crucial to approach wellness goals, especially weight loss, with realistic expectations. While lemon water offers numerous health benefits and can be a supportive tool, it is not a magic bullet. True weight loss and sustainable wellness are the result of consistent, holistic efforts.

What Lemon Water Can Do:

  • Support Hydration: It helps you drink more water, which is fundamental for all bodily functions, including metabolism and satiety.
  • Aid Digestion: The citric acid can stimulate digestive enzymes and help prevent occasional bloating and constipation.
  • Provide Nutrients: It offers a good source of vitamin C and antioxidants, supporting immune function and skin health.
  • Be a Low-Calorie Beverage Alternative: It can replace sugary drinks, reducing overall calorie intake.

What Lemon Water Cannot Do:

  • Burn Belly Fat Directly: There is no scientific evidence that lemon water directly "burns" fat, especially belly fat. Fat loss is a complex process influenced by calorie deficit, metabolism, and overall lifestyle.
  • Detox the Body: Your liver and kidneys are incredibly efficient at detoxifying your body. While lemon water supports these organs by promoting hydration, it does not have unique "detox" properties beyond what regular water provides.
  • Cure Diseases: Lemon water is a healthy beverage, but it should not be considered a cure or treatment for any medical condition. Always consult with a healthcare professional for specific health concerns.

Common Misconceptions to Avoid:

  • The "Pink Salt Trick": Some social media trends claim that adding pink salt to lemon water significantly enhances weight loss or detoxification. Experts agree there's no scientific proof for these claims. While pink salt provides electrolytes, its benefits for weight loss are minimal and primarily come from increased hydration, not special properties of the salt. Most people already consume enough sodium, so adding more isn't necessarily beneficial.
  • Extreme pH Balancing: While lemons are acidic, when metabolized, they can have an alkalizing effect on the body. However, the idea that you need to drastically change your body's pH through diet is largely unsupported by science. Your body has robust mechanisms to maintain its pH balance.

Sustainable weight loss involves a combination of factors: a balanced, nutrient-dense diet, regular physical activity, adequate sleep, stress management, and consistent hydration. Lemon water is a valuable piece of this puzzle, but it's important to view it within this broader context.

Potential Side Effects and Considerations

While lemon water is generally safe for most people, it's important to be aware of potential side effects and consume it thoughtfully.

  • Tooth Enamel Erosion: The citric acid in lemons can erode tooth enamel over time. To minimize this risk:
    • Drink lemon water through a straw.
    • Rinse your mouth with plain water immediately after drinking lemon water.
    • Avoid brushing your teeth immediately after consuming acidic beverages, as enamel is softened and more susceptible to wear. Wait at least 30 minutes.
  • Heartburn/GERD: For some individuals, the acidity of lemons can trigger or worsen heartburn or gastroesophageal reflux disease (GERD). If you experience this, try reducing the amount of lemon juice, diluting it more, or discontinuing use if symptoms persist.
  • Frequency and Amount: While beneficial, moderation is key. One or two glasses of lemon water per day, using the juice of half a lemon per glass, typically provides benefits without excessive acidity. Listen to your body and adjust accordingly.
  • Medication Interactions: If you are on any medications, particularly those for kidney conditions or those that affect stomach acid, consult your healthcare provider before making significant dietary changes, including regular consumption of lemon water.

For most healthy individuals, incorporating lemon water into a daily routine is a safe and beneficial practice. The key is to be mindful of your body's responses and to practice good oral hygiene.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is lemon water good for burning belly fat?

While lemon water can support overall weight management by promoting hydration, aiding digestion, and potentially reducing calorie intake by replacing sugary drinks, there is no scientific evidence that it directly "burns" belly fat. Fat loss occurs through a calorie deficit and a balanced approach of diet and exercise, not from specific foods or beverages targeting particular areas of the body.

How much lemon water should I drink a day for weight loss benefits?

Generally, one to two glasses of lemon water per day, each made with the juice of half a lemon squeezed into 8-12 ounces of water, can provide benefits. This amount helps with hydration and provides vitamin C without excessive acidity that could harm tooth enamel. It’s best to listen to your body and consult with a healthcare professional if you have any concerns, especially regarding existing health conditions.

Does hot or cold lemon water make a difference for weight loss?

The temperature of your lemon water is largely a matter of personal preference. Cold lemon water might slightly increase your body's internal temperature, leading to a minimal increase in calorie burn as your body works to warm it up. Warm lemon water is often considered soothing and may stimulate digestion for some individuals. Both provide hydration and the benefits of lemon, so choose what you find most enjoyable and sustainable for your routine.

Can lemon water replace sugary drinks for weight loss?

Absolutely! One of the most significant ways lemon water can support weight loss is by serving as a refreshing, zero-calorie alternative to sugar-sweetened beverages like sodas, fruit juices, and sweetened teas. Replacing these high-calorie drinks with lemon water can substantially reduce your daily caloric intake, contributing directly to a calorie deficit necessary for weight loss.
